Sprinter Noah Lyles secured a victory in the 100-meter event at the recent track meet held in Rome. Lyles demonstrated his dominance on the track, maintaining his strong performance in the sprinting discipline. Meanwhile, the javelin competition saw a surprising result from athlete Pathirage. Pathirage delivered a stunning throw that upended expectations and secured a notable win. The event highlighted the competitive nature of the field in both the sprinting and throwing categories. These performances add to the athletes' profiles as they prepare for upcoming international competitions. Spectators in Rome witnessed high-level athletics across multiple disciplines during the meet. The results underscore the depth of talent currently present in global track and field events.
